Essential Tips for a Successful Job Interview

A job interview is your chance to make a great impression and land your dream job. To help you succeed, here are 15 essential tips to ensure you are well-prepared and confident for your next interview.

Before the Interview

1. Research the Company

Understand the company’s mission, values, recent news, and culture. This helps you align your responses with their expectations.

2. Understand the Job Description

Analyze the job posting and align your skills and experience with the role’s requirements.

3. Practice Common Interview Questions

Prepare answers for common interview questions using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) for behavioral questions.

4. Know Your Resume Inside Out

Be ready to explain every experience and skill mentioned in your resume.

5. Prepare Thoughtful Questions

Have at least 3-5 insightful questions to ask the interviewer about the role, company, and growth opportunities.

6. Dress Appropriately

Choose professional attire based on the company’s dress code. It’s always better to be slightly overdressed than underdressed.

7. Plan Your Journey

If the interview is in person, plan your route and allow extra time for delays. For virtual interviews, test your technology beforehand.

During the Interview

8. Make a Strong First Impression

Greet with a firm handshake, a smile, and confident body language.

9. Maintain Eye Contact and Positive Body Language

Show engagement and confidence through your posture and facial expressions.

10. Listen Carefully and Respond Thoughtfully

Take a moment to understand each question before answering clearly and concisely.

11. Highlight Your Strengths with Examples

Use specific examples to showcase your skills, accomplishments, and problem-solving abilities.

12. Stay Positive

Avoid speaking negatively about previous employers or experiences, even if they were challenging.

13. Keep Your Answers Concise and Relevant

Stick to the point and avoid rambling. Keep responses structured and impactful.

After the Interview

14. Send a Thank-You Email

Express appreciation for the opportunity, reiterate your enthusiasm, and briefly mention how your skills align with the role.

15. Follow Up Professionally

If you don’t hear back within the expected timeline, send a polite follow-up email to inquire about the next steps.
